I couldn't find a picture of mine online, but I'm using a toothbrush holder from Walmart. It's a brushed aluminum finish, has 4 holes around the outside and a larger hole in the middle. The 4 outside holes are perfect for eGo-sized batteries, while the center hole works for a larger tube mod. I'm eventually going to buy some wood and build a bigger caddy something along the lines of what cramptholomew built, just haven't gotten around to it yet.
